日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問(wèn)題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)實(shí)現(xiàn)方法解析(網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ì))

隨著信息技術(shù)的不斷發(fā)展,教育領(lǐng)域也在不斷進(jìn)行著數(shù)字化轉(zhuǎn)型,多數(shù)大學(xué)都已經(jīng)實(shí)現(xiàn)了網(wǎng)上選課系統(tǒng)。這一系統(tǒng)極大地方便了師生的選課、排課和管理工作,是現(xiàn)代高校教育信息化建設(shè)中不可或缺的一項(xiàng)重要工具。而網(wǎng)上選課系統(tǒng)的成功應(yīng)用建立在數(shù)據(jù)庫(kù)的良好設(shè)計(jì)與實(shí)現(xiàn)上,本文將對(duì)網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)的設(shè)計(jì)實(shí)現(xiàn)方法進(jìn)行解析。

站在用戶的角度思考問(wèn)題,與客戶深入溝通,找到伊寧網(wǎng)站設(shè)計(jì)與伊寧網(wǎng)站推廣的解決方案,憑借多年的經(jīng)驗(yàn),讓設(shè)計(jì)與互聯(lián)網(wǎng)技術(shù)結(jié)合,創(chuàng)造個(gè)性化、用戶體驗(yàn)好的作品,建站類型包括:網(wǎng)站設(shè)計(jì)制作、網(wǎng)站制作、企業(yè)官網(wǎng)、英文網(wǎng)站、手機(jī)端網(wǎng)站、網(wǎng)站推廣、域名注冊(cè)、網(wǎng)絡(luò)空間、企業(yè)郵箱。業(yè)務(wù)覆蓋伊寧地區(qū)。

一、系統(tǒng)需求分析

在數(shù)據(jù)庫(kù)的設(shè)計(jì)與實(shí)現(xiàn)之前,我們首先需要進(jìn)行系統(tǒng)需求分析。網(wǎng)上選課系統(tǒng)的主要功能為學(xué)生進(jìn)行選課、退課、查看選課結(jié)果;教師進(jìn)行課程安排、授課計(jì)劃等。因此,我們需要對(duì)系統(tǒng)的基本需求進(jìn)行分析,以便設(shè)計(jì)出合理的數(shù)據(jù)庫(kù)架構(gòu)。

對(duì)于學(xué)生而言,他們需要進(jìn)行的主要操作為選課和退課。在選課時(shí),學(xué)生需要能夠?yàn)g覽所有開(kāi)設(shè)的課程信息,并根據(jù)自己的喜好和學(xué)習(xí)計(jì)劃進(jìn)行選擇。在完成選課之后,學(xué)生需要能夠查詢自己的選課結(jié)果,并進(jìn)行退課等操作。

對(duì)于教師而言,他們需要進(jìn)行的主要操作為制定授課計(jì)劃、開(kāi)設(shè)課程以及查看選課情況等。因此,系統(tǒng)需要提供教師的個(gè)人信息以及授課計(jì)劃表、課程信息表等信息。

二、數(shù)據(jù)庫(kù)設(shè)計(jì)原則

在進(jìn)行網(wǎng)上選課系統(tǒng)的數(shù)據(jù)庫(kù)設(shè)計(jì)時(shí),需要考慮以下幾個(gè)原則:

1. 數(shù)據(jù)庫(kù)的安全性:網(wǎng)上選課系統(tǒng)中涉及到學(xué)生的個(gè)人信息和選課成績(jī)等敏感數(shù)據(jù),因此需要加強(qiáng)對(duì)數(shù)據(jù)庫(kù)的安全性保護(hù)。

2. 數(shù)據(jù)庫(kù)的可擴(kuò)展性:在系統(tǒng)的實(shí)際使用中,可能會(huì)出現(xiàn)新增數(shù)據(jù)表或字段的情況,因此數(shù)據(jù)庫(kù)需要具備一定的可擴(kuò)展性。

3. 數(shù)據(jù)庫(kù)的一致性:在進(jìn)行數(shù)據(jù)庫(kù)設(shè)計(jì)時(shí),需要注重?cái)?shù)據(jù)的一致性,避免出現(xiàn)數(shù)據(jù)冗余和數(shù)據(jù)丟失等情況。

4. 數(shù)據(jù)庫(kù)的性能:網(wǎng)上選課系統(tǒng)的訪問(wèn)量可能會(huì)比較大,因此需要考慮數(shù)據(jù)庫(kù)的性能問(wèn)題,保證系統(tǒng)的快速響應(yīng)。

5. 數(shù)據(jù)庫(kù)的易用性:在實(shí)際應(yīng)用中,系統(tǒng)的使用者可能會(huì)涉及到多個(gè)角色,因此需要將不同的角色之間的數(shù)據(jù)進(jìn)行分離,以提高數(shù)據(jù)庫(kù)的易用性。

基于以上原則,我們可以根據(jù)學(xué)生和教師的角色及其對(duì)應(yīng)的操作,進(jìn)行數(shù)據(jù)庫(kù)的設(shè)計(jì)實(shí)現(xiàn)。

三、數(shù)據(jù)表設(shè)計(jì)

1. 學(xué)生信息表

學(xué)生信息表主要用于存儲(chǔ)學(xué)生的個(gè)人信息,如姓名、學(xué)號(hào)、所在院系、班級(jí)等。該表的設(shè)計(jì)可以選擇如下字段:

| 字段名 | 數(shù)據(jù)類型 | 鍵類型 | 是否可為空 |

| —— | ——– | —— | ———- |

| id | int | 主鍵 | 否 |

| name | varchar | | 否 |

| sno | varchar | | 否 |

| dept | varchar | | 否 |

| class | varchar | | 否 |

| tel | varchar | | 是 |

| eml | varchar | | 是 |

| passwd | varchar | | 否 |

2. 教師信息表

教師信息表用于存儲(chǔ)教師的個(gè)人信息,如姓名、工號(hào)、所授課程等。該表的設(shè)計(jì)可以選擇如下字段:

| 字段名 | 數(shù)據(jù)類型 | 鍵類型 | 是否可為空 |

| —— | ——– | —— | ———- |

| id | int | 主鍵 | 否 |

| name | varchar | | 否 |

| tno | varchar | | 否 |

| dept | varchar | | 否 |

| subject| varchar | | 否 |

| title | varchar | | 否 |

| passwd | varchar | | 否 |

3. 課程信息表

課程信息表主要用于存儲(chǔ)每個(gè)學(xué)期開(kāi)設(shè)的課程信息,如課程名稱、授課教師、學(xué)分等。該表的設(shè)計(jì)可以選擇如下字段:

| 字段名 | 數(shù)據(jù)類型 | 鍵類型 | 是否可為空 |

| ——— | ——– | —— | ———- |

| course_id | int | 主鍵 | 否 |

| cno | varchar | | 否 |

| name | varchar | | 否 |

| teacher | varchar | | 否 |

| credit | int | | 否 |

| limit_num | int | | 否 |

| rem_num | int | | 是 |

4. 選課信息表

選課信息表用于存儲(chǔ)學(xué)生的選課信息,即學(xué)生選擇了哪些課程。該表的設(shè)計(jì)可以選擇如下字段:

| 字段名 | 數(shù)據(jù)類型 | 鍵類型 | 是否可為空 |

| ———– | ——– | —— | ———- |

| s2c_id | int | 主鍵 | 否 |

| student_id | int | 外鍵 | 否 |

| course_id | int | 外鍵 | 否 |

| select_time | datetime | | 否 |

5. 成績(jī)信息表

成績(jī)信息表用于存儲(chǔ)學(xué)生的成績(jī)信息,即學(xué)生在每門(mén)選修的課程中所獲得的成績(jī)。該表的設(shè)計(jì)可以選擇如下字段:

| 字段名 | 數(shù)據(jù)類型 | 鍵類型 | 是否可為空 |

| ———- | ——– | —— | ———- |

| sc_id | int | 主鍵 | 否 |

| student_id | int | 外鍵 | 否 |

| course_id | int | 外鍵 | 否 |

| score | int | | 否 |

6. 授課計(jì)劃表

授課計(jì)劃表用于記錄每個(gè)教師每個(gè)學(xué)期的授課計(jì)劃,即教師需要開(kāi)設(shè)哪些課程。該表的設(shè)計(jì)可以選擇如下字段:

| 字段名 | 數(shù)據(jù)類型 | 鍵類型 | 是否可為空 |

| ———- | ——– | —— | ———- |

| t2c_id | int | 主鍵 | 否 |

| teacher_id | int | 外鍵 | 否 |

| course_id | int | 外鍵 | 否 |

| class_time | varchar | | 否 |

四、數(shù)據(jù)庫(kù)實(shí)現(xiàn)

以上是網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)的基本思路,接下來(lái)需要通過(guò) MySQL 或 Oracle 數(shù)據(jù)庫(kù)等工具進(jìn)行實(shí)現(xiàn)。數(shù)據(jù)庫(kù)表結(jié)構(gòu)的設(shè)計(jì)基本要求是必要字段不能為空,建議將部分字段設(shè)為唯一鍵或主鍵,以提高數(shù)據(jù)庫(kù)的操作效率。在數(shù)據(jù)表的設(shè)計(jì)過(guò)程中,還需要進(jìn)行表關(guān)聯(lián),將各個(gè)表之間的數(shù)據(jù)進(jìn)行關(guān)聯(lián),以便系統(tǒng)可以根據(jù)這些關(guān)聯(lián)信息實(shí)現(xiàn)各項(xiàng)功能的呈現(xiàn)。

總體而言,網(wǎng)上選課系統(tǒng)的數(shù)據(jù)庫(kù)設(shè)計(jì)實(shí)現(xiàn)需要考慮多方面的因素,包括系統(tǒng)需求分析、數(shù)據(jù)庫(kù)設(shè)計(jì)原則、數(shù)據(jù)表設(shè)計(jì)和數(shù)據(jù)庫(kù)實(shí)現(xiàn)等方面。在設(shè)計(jì)時(shí)要注重?cái)?shù)據(jù)的一致性、可擴(kuò)展性和安全性,以提高系統(tǒng)的效率和可靠性。

成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ián),建站經(jīng)驗(yàn)豐富以策略為先導(dǎo)10多年以來(lái)專注數(shù)字化網(wǎng)站建設(shè),提供企業(yè)網(wǎng)站建設(shè),高端網(wǎng)站設(shè)計(jì),響應(yīng)式網(wǎng)站制作,設(shè)計(jì)師量身打造品牌風(fēng)格,熱線:028-86922220

學(xué)生信息管理系統(tǒng)的數(shù)據(jù)庫(kù)設(shè)計(jì)

選修課一張表:課程,課程編號(hào)

學(xué)生一張表:個(gè)人信息,學(xué)號(hào)(班級(jí)學(xué)院可在做一張關(guān)聯(lián)也可在這張表里,關(guān)聯(lián)的話,會(huì)有一個(gè)班級(jí)的屬性,會(huì)再多一張班級(jí)表)

映射關(guān)系一張表:課程編號(hào)、學(xué)號(hào)(成績(jī))

通過(guò)最后一張表關(guān)聯(lián)前兩張就可以了,可以再最后一張里加成績(jī),就成了成績(jī)與科目人關(guān)聯(lián)的表了

主鍵、外鍵都是學(xué)號(hào)和課程編號(hào)

網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ì),網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)實(shí)現(xiàn)方法解析,學(xué)生信息管理系統(tǒng)的數(shù)據(jù)庫(kù)設(shè)計(jì)的信息別忘了在本站進(jìn)行查找喔。

成都網(wǎng)站建設(shè)選創(chuàng)新互聯(lián)(?:028-86922220),專業(yè)從事成都網(wǎng)站制作設(shè)計(jì),高端小程序APP定制開(kāi)發(fā),成都網(wǎng)絡(luò)營(yíng)銷推廣等一站式服務(wù)。


本文題目:網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)實(shí)現(xiàn)方法解析(網(wǎng)上選課系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ì))
網(wǎng)站URL:http://m.5511xx.com/article/coocohj.html